Hello, I need some assistance on how to code for labs being done for travel clearance. We have a patient who needed a Hemoglobin and a UA done. That is all they came in for no office visit done. Physician used ICD code Z91.89 Other specified personnel risk factors, not elsewhere classified. I'm not completely confident that this is the correct ICD to use. I could really use some guidance on coding for travel purposes as I am having a hard time finding information on this.
